Unattended and Scripted Silent Installation
You can use the Dell Systems Management Tools and Documentation DVD
to perform an unattended and scripted silent installation of managed systems
software through the command line (using RPM packages) on systems running
supported Red Hat
®
Enterprise Linux
®
and SUSE
®
Linux Enterprise Server
operating systems.
Before You Begin
Read the installation requirements to ensure that your system meets or
exceeds the minimum requirements.
Read the
Dell OpenManage Server Administrator Compatibility Guide
.
This guide contains compatibility information about Server Administrator
installation and operation on various hardware platforms running
supported Microsoft
®
Windows
®
, Red Hat Enterprise Linux, and SUSE
Linux Enterprise Server operating systems.
Read the Dell OpenManage installation
readme_ins.txt
and the Server
Administrator readme files on the
Dell Systems Management Tools and
Documentation
DVD. These files contain the latest information about new
features, fixes, hardware requirements, software, firmware, and driver
versions, in addition to information about known issues.
Read the installation instructions for your operating system.
Ensure that all operating system RPM packages that the Server
Administrator RPMs require are installed.
